Analyze glucose patterns including dawn phenomenon (early morning rise), meal responses, and overnight stability. Helps identify recurring patterns that may need attention or treatment adjustments.
AI agents call get_glucose_trends to retrieve information from LibreLink MCP Server without modifying anything — typically the context-gathering step in research, monitoring, and reporting workflows, before the agent takes action elsewhere.
This tool retrieves and analyzes historical glucose data to present trend analysis. It performs read-only operations on personal health data without creating, modifying, deleting, or executing any changes. While the data is sensitive (personal medical information), the tool itself has no capability to alter records, trigger treatments, or cause destructive effects.
From the tool's definition Tool name 'get_glucose_trends' and description explicitly states it 'Analyze[s] glucose patterns' and 'identify[s] recurring patterns' — purely analytical operations with no modification, deletion, or execution of external systems.

get_glucose_trends is a Read tool with low risk. Read-only tools are generally safe to allow by default.
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the get_glucose_trends r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.
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for get_glucose_trends.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
get_glucose_trends is provided by the LibreLink MCP Server MCP server (sedoglia/librelink-mcp-server). PolicyLayer sits as a proxy in front of this server to enforce policies before tool calls reach the server.
